Note:   LATHAM, OF BRADWALL. LATHAM, JOHN, esq. of Bradwall Hall, in the county of Chester, M.D. of Brasenose College, Oxford, late President of the Royal College of Physicians, London, F.R.S. L.S. &c. b. 29th December, 1761, m. 12th April, 1784, Mary, eldest daughter and co-heiress of the Reverend Peter Meyer, (see family of Meyer at foot) Vicar of Prestbury, and has issue,
  JOHN, LL.D. sometime of All Soul's college, Oxford, b. 18th March, 1787; m. Elizabeth, daughter of Sir Henry Dampier, knt. late one of the judges of the court of king's bench.
 Peter-Mere, M.D. of Brasenose college, Oxford, fellow of the royal college of physicians, b. 1st July, 1789; m. Diana-Clarissa, daughter of Major-general the Hon. Granville-Anson Chetwynd-Stapylton.
 Henry, M.A. of Brasenose College, Oxford, in holy orders, b. 4th November, 1794; m. Maria, daughter of James Halliwell, esq. of Broomfield, in Lancashire.
 Sarah, m. to George Ormerod, esq. of Sedbury Park, in the county of Gloucester, and has issue. Frances, d. unmarried in 1829.
  Doctor Latham succeeded his father 21st June, 1783.
